diff options
author | Peter Gielda <pgielda@antmicro.com> | 2013-04-08 20:10:46 +0200 |
---|---|---|
committer | Marcel Ziswiler <marcel.ziswiler@toradex.com> | 2013-04-12 16:20:35 +0200 |
commit | 080c3135b58aa700851991fb672e6c33cf16d9d9 (patch) | |
tree | 5d9bc2a5ce5611d2179d3796e4f5f68c9328b00f /drivers/media/video | |
parent | 590671f265f70e6601d7bd21a3bc909f1935a047 (diff) |
tegra_v4l2: map memory as non-cachable and fix the allocation problem
Diffstat (limited to 'drivers/media/video')
-rw-r--r-- | drivers/media/video/videobuf2-dma-nvmap.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/media/video/videobuf2-dma-nvmap.c b/drivers/media/video/videobuf2-dma-nvmap.c index 27f43e5a3a57..99413e119d22 100644 --- a/drivers/media/video/videobuf2-dma-nvmap.c +++ b/drivers/media/video/videobuf2-dma-nvmap.c @@ -54,7 +54,7 @@ static void *vb2_dma_nvmap_alloc(void *alloc_ctx, unsigned long size) } buf->nvmap_ref = nvmap_alloc(conf->nvmap_client, size, 32, - NVMAP_HANDLE_CACHEABLE, NVMAP_HEAP_SYSMEM); + NVMAP_HANDLE_UNCACHEABLE, NVMAP_HEAP_SYSMEM | NVMAP_HEAP_CARVEOUT_GENERIC); if (IS_ERR(buf->nvmap_ref)) { dev_err(conf->dev, "nvmap_alloc failed\n"); ret = -ENOMEM; |